An exciting opportunity has arisen for a motivated and knowledgeable Gallery Manager to lead Cornish Masters in St Ives; a respected commercial gallery specialising in works from the Newlyn School and St Ives Modernist movement. We are seeking a confident and personable individual with proven sales ability, curatorial awareness, and a genuine passion for art. A strong knowledge of the Newlyn School and St Ives Modernist artists is highly desirable; however, for the right candidate, this may be further developed in post. Above all, applicants should demonstrate a serious interest in art history, particularly Cornwall’s rich artistic heritage.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Managing the day-to-day running of the gallery
  • Engaging walk-in visitors and hosting private viewings
  • Driving sales and building client relationships
  • Assisting the curation and exhibition planning
  • Maintaining social media platforms and digital marketing campaigns
  • Producing written content for marketing and promotional materials
